Top 10 Healthy Foods You Should Be Eating Every Day


Maintaining a healthy diet is essential for overall well-being and longevity. The foods we consume play a significant role in our physical and mental health. Incorporating a variety of nutrient-rich foods into our daily meals can provide us with the energy and nutrients needed to thrive. Here’s a list of healthy foods that you should consider including in your daily diet for optimal health.

1. Leafy Greens

Leafy greens such as spinach, kale, and Swiss chard are packed with vitamins, minerals, and fiber. They are low in calories and high in antioxidants, which help protect your body from oxidative stress. The presence of folate and vitamin K in these greens contributes to bone health and blood clotting.

2. Berries

Berries, including blueberries, strawberries, and raspberries, are not only delicious but also rich in antioxidants, vitamins, and fiber. Their vibrant colors indicate the presence of powerful compounds that support brain health, reduce inflammation, and boost the immune system.

3. Nuts and Seeds

Nuts like almonds, walnuts, and seeds like chia and flaxseeds are excellent sources of healthy fats, protein, and essential nutrients. These foods contribute to heart health, promote satiety, and provide a dose of omega-3 fatty acids that are beneficial for brain function.

4. Whole Grains

Incorporating whole grains like quinoa, brown rice, and whole wheat into your diet provides complex carbohydrates, fiber, and various vitamins and minerals. These foods release energy gradually, helping to maintain steady blood sugar levels and promoting digestive health.

5. Lean Proteins

Lean proteins like chicken, turkey, fish, tofu, and legumes offer essential amino acids necessary for muscle repair and growth. They are also low in saturated fats, making them heart-friendly choices for maintaining a balanced diet.

6. Greek Yogurt

Greek yogurt is rich in protein and probiotics, which support gut health and aid digestion. It’s a versatile ingredient that can be enjoyed as a snack, breakfast, or used in various recipes.

7. Avocado

Avocado is a nutrient-dense fruit that provides healthy monounsaturated fats, fiber, and potassium. These fats are beneficial for heart health and can help reduce bad cholesterol levels.

8. Cruciferous Vegetables

Vegetables like broccoli, cauliflower, and Brussels sprouts belong to the cruciferous family and are known for their cancer-fighting properties. They are also high in fiber and vitamins that contribute to overall health.

9. Oily Fish

Fish with a high fat content, such as salmon, mackerel, and sardines, are an excellent source of omega-3 fatty acids, which have been shown to reduce inflammation and are beneficial to cardiovascular health. Including these fish in your diet may have a beneficial effect on the functioning of your brain as well as your mood.

10. Colorful Vegetables

You should make it a point to incorporate a wide range of brightly colored veggies like carrots, peppers, and sweet potatoes into your diet. These vivacious foods offer a wide variety of vitamins, minerals, and antioxidants, all of which help to the development of a strong immune system and general vitality.


The decision to prioritize a diet that incorporates these items high in nutrient density can have a substantial impact on both your health and well-being. Keep in mind that diversity is the most important thing; by include a variety of healthy options in your diet, you ensure that you are getting a wide range of critical nutrients. You may pave the path for a healthier and happier life by adopting a few modifications to your regular eating habits that are realistic and can be maintained over time. Before making any changes to your diet, you should always discuss your options with a qualified medical practitioner or a licensed dietitian, particularly if you have any preexisting health conditions.

Leave a Comment